What is GHRP-6?
GHRP-6 is a lab-made peptide — a chain of just six amino acids (sequence His-D-Trp-Ala-Trp-D-Phe-Lys-NH2, molecular formula C46H56N12O6, molecular weight ~873). It belongs to a family called growth-hormone-releasing peptides (GHRPs), and it holds a place in science history: GHRP-6 was one of the synthetic molecules that led researchers to the “ghrelin receptor” and, eventually, to the discovery of ghrelin itself, the body’s own hunger-and-GH hormone (GHRP-6 research on PubMed). GHRP-6 is not a medicine you can be prescribed and not a supplement you can legally buy as food — in the United States it exists only as a research chemical.
How does GHRP-6 work?
GHRP-6 works by plugging into the growth hormone secretagogue receptor (GHS-R1a) — the same receptor the natural hunger hormone ghrelin uses. Think of that receptor as a doorbell for two things at once: press it and the pituitary releases a pulse of growth hormone, while the hunger centers in the brain light up. GHRP-6 also pairs powerfully with GHRH (the body’s other GH signal), so the two together produce a bigger GH pulse than either alone. The same button-press transiently nudges cortisol and prolactin upward, which is why those two hormones show up in the side-effect conversation (Bowers et al., 1990).
What does the research show?
GHRP-6 has more human data behind it than most research peptides, but the data proves a narrower thing than the marketing implies. In controlled human studies — including randomized, placebo-controlled pharmacology work — a single dose of GHRP-6 reliably raises growth hormone, especially alongside GHRH (Bowers et al., 1990). That the GH pulse is real is about as settled as anything in this space. What is not settled is the leap most people care about: that a bigger GH pulse turns into visible muscle, fat loss, or a younger-feeling body. No human trial demonstrates GHRP-6 changing body composition — so on physique, GHRP-6 sits at mechanistic-hypothesis, none-in-humans, not “proven.” Separately, a smaller line of mostly animal and cell research has explored GHRP-6 as a tissue- and heart-protective agent; that work is early, preclinical, and does not translate to physique benefits.
What the community reports
Outside the lab, GHRP-6 has a long-running following among bodybuilders and people trying to eat more during a bulk, where its reputation is the “fridge raid” — a hunger wave strong enough to push through a suppressed appetite. The commonly reported pattern is a subcutaneous dose in the low hundreds of micrograms (around 100 mcg is the figure most often mentioned) taken before meals, sometimes paired with a GHRH peptide. These accounts are anecdotal — they aren’t controlled data, they suffer from survivorship bias, and they can’t tell you how often GHRP-6 does nothing or how the cortisol and prolactin bumps add up over time. They explain why people are interested; they don’t prove it works.
Is GHRP-6 safe? Side effects
GHRP-6’s honest safety answer is “the short-term effects are well mapped, the long-term ones aren’t.” The most reliable effect is a strong appetite surge — sometimes a benefit, sometimes exactly what someone dieting doesn’t want. GHRP-6 also transiently raises cortisol and prolactin, and those bumps grow with higher, more frequent dosing, which is the main reason people cap the dose and the duration. Other reported effects include water retention, tingling or numbness in the hands, flushing or a brief head-rush after injection, tiredness, and — because growth hormone itself does this — higher blood sugar and reduced insulin sensitivity. There is no long-term human safety trial. And the practical risk skews to the source: research-chemical vials are unregulated, so their purity, the accuracy of the dose, and their sterility depend entirely on the outfit selling them.
FDA & legal status (2026)
GHRP-6 is not FDA-approved, and it is not a legal dietary supplement either. In the United States it is sold strictly as a research chemical, labeled “not for human use,” and the FDA has taken action against products that market growth-hormone secretagogues for human consumption (FDA Drugs). Is GHRP-6 banned in sport?
Yes. GHRP-6 is a growth hormone secretagogue, and WADA names that class explicitly under S2.2 of its Prohibited List, so GHRP-6 is banned at all times — in and out of competition — for any athlete under anti-doping rules (WADA/USADA Prohibited List). This is not a gray area: GH secretagogues are one of the more clearly named categories on the list, and they are detectable.

GHRP-6 vs the other GH secretagogues
GHRP-6 is one of a whole family of GH secretagogues, and the differences are mostly about side-effects and appetite. In plain terms: GHRP-6 gives the biggest hunger hit of the group; GHRP-2 raises GH a bit harder with somewhat less hunger; ipamorelin is the “clean” one, prized for a GH pulse with minimal cortisol, prolactin or appetite; and CJC-1295 is a different type (a GHRH analog) that pairs with any of them. None of these has human-trial proof for muscle or fat-loss outcomes. Frequently asked questions
Does GHRP-6 actually work?
It depends what you mean by “work.” GHRP-6 reliably raises growth hormone in humans — that part is well documented. What it has not been shown to do in any human trial is build muscle, strip fat, or reverse aging. So it works as a GH-releasing and appetite-boosting agent, and remains unproven as a physique drug.
Is GHRP-6 legal?
GHRP-6 is legal to buy and sell in the United States as a research chemical, but it is not an approved drug or a legal dietary supplement, and it cannot be sold for human consumption. That’s why every vendor labels it “for research use only.”
Does GHRP-6 raise cortisol and prolactin?
Yes, transiently. GHRP-6 nudges both cortisol and prolactin upward, and the bump tends to grow with higher and more frequent dosing. That’s the main reason people who use it keep the dose modest and the runs short, and why prolactin-sensitive users are especially cautious.
How do people take GHRP-6?
In the research and community literature GHRP-6 is almost always injected subcutaneously after being reconstituted with bacteriostatic water, in doses commonly reported around 100 mcg, often before a meal and sometimes alongside a GHRH peptide. This is reported use, not a recommended protocol.
Why does GHRP-6 make you so hungry?
Because GHRP-6 activates the ghrelin receptor (GHS-R1a), the same receptor the body’s natural hunger hormone uses. Pressing that receptor turns on appetite directly — which is why GHRP-6 has a reputation for a powerful “fridge raid” effect, stronger than most of the other GH peptides.
What’s the difference between GHRP-6 and ghrelin?
Ghrelin is the hormone your own stomach makes; GHRP-6 is a synthetic molecule that mimics part of what ghrelin does at the GHS-R1a receptor. Historically, GHRP-6 came first as a research tool, and chasing how it worked is part of what led scientists to discover ghrelin.

Evidence by outcome
Each outcome GHRP-6 has been studied for, with the honest evidence grade and what the studies actually found. A tier never stands alone — the verdict rides with it.
| Outcome | Evidence | What was found |
|---|---|---|
| Growth hormone (GH) release | Human RCTHelped | Human pharmacology studies, including randomized and placebo-controlled designs, consistently show that a single dose of GHRP-6 triggers a real, repeatable pulse of growth hormone — and that it works synergistically with GHRH. This is the compound's best-established human effect. The catch: raising GH acutely is a hormonal response, not a body-composition result. |
| Appetite / hunger | Human observationalHelped | GHRP-6 activates the ghrelin receptor, and in people who use it a strong rise in hunger is one of the most consistently reported effects. There is no controlled GHRP-6 food-intake trial, though — the appetite case rests on ghrelin-receptor pharmacology plus uncontrolled human reports, so we grade it observational, not proven. For people who want to eat more it's a feature; for anyone watching calories it's the opposite. |
| Muscle gain, fat loss & body recomposition | MechanisticUnclear⚠ none in humans | No human trial shows GHRP-6 builds muscle, cuts fat, or "recomps" a body. The reasoning is a chain of hypotheses — GHRP-6 raises GH, GH influences body composition, therefore GHRP-6 should reshape you — and each link past the first is unproven for this peptide. Treat physique claims as a hypothesis, not a finding. |
